Venkamma Kusappa Guttedar Degree College, Aland, Kalaburagi, is a notable institution established in 1994. Affiliated with Kalaburagi University, it offers core undergraduate programs in Arts, Commerce, and Science, dedicated to fostering accessible higher education in Karnataka.

Must-Visit Tourist Spots

Gulbarga Fort

approx. 50 km

A historic fort with several structures, including mosques and tombs, reflecting Bahmani architecture.

Khwaja Bande Nawaz Dargah

approx. 50 km

A famous Sufi shrine and a significant pilgrimage site for devotees of all faiths.

Sharana Basaveshwara Temple

approx. 50 km

An important Hindu temple known for its annual fair and the saint's Samadhi.

Buddha Vihar

approx. 55 km

A grand Buddhist monument and meditation center, built in the style of Sanchi stupa.

Jama Masjid, Gulbarga

approx. 50 km

A unique mosque built inside Gulbarga Fort, notable for having no minarets and a large dome.

Deval Ganagapur

approx. 30 km

A highly revered pilgrimage site dedicated to Lord Dattatreya, believed to be the second incarnation of Narasimha Saraswati.

Manyakheta

approx. 40 km

The ancient capital of the Rashtrakuta dynasty, now an archaeological site with historical ruins.

Sannati

approx. 90 km

An ancient Buddhist site and archaeological excavation area, home to the Chandrala Parameswari Temple.
